Size and weight are big decision factors when you are trying to find the ideal camera for your needs.
In this section, we are going to illustrate the Sony WX70 and Sony WX30 side-by-side from the front, back and top in their relative dimensions. Sony WX70 has external dimensions of 92 x 52 x 19 mm (3.62 x 2.05 x 0.75″) and weighs 114 g (0.25 lb / 4.02 oz) (including batteries). Sony WX30 has external dimensions of 92 x 52 x 19 mm (3.62 x 2.05 x 0.75″) and weighs 117 g (0.26 lb / 4.13 oz) (including batteries).
Below you can see the front-view size comparison of the Sony WX70 and the Sony WX30. In this case, we can see that Sony WX70 and Sony WX30 have the exact same height, width and thickness.

Weight is another important factor, especially when deciding on a camera that you want to carry with you all day.
Sony WX70 is 3g lighter than the Sony WX30 but we don't think this will make a significant difference.
Weather Sealing
Unfortunately neither the Sony Cyber-shot DSC-WX70 nor Sony Cyber-shot DSC-WX30 provides any type of weather sealing in their bodies, so you have to give extra care especially when you are shooting outdoors. LCD Screen Size and Features
Sony WX70 and Sony WX30's LCD screens have the same diagonal size of 3.00 inches.
Unfortunately, both cameras has fixed screens so they don't tilt or flip in directions.
